Josh Smith's agent spoke with Danny Ferry on Wednesday to discuss his client's "frustration" with the Atlanta Hawks' recent spiral.

"As far as moving forward and whatever changes will be made, that's more so management's job to field those calls and make the decisions they feel like are best to move forward," Smith's agent, Wallace Prather, told CBSSports.com.

Prather stopped short of requesting a trade.

Smith will be an unrestricted free agent this offseason.

The Hawks have conducted trade talks centered on Smith with multiple teams, according to NBA executives.

Via Ken Berger/CBS Sports
